About McKayla Young
Miss Smithfield 2025 | Miss North Carolina Candidate
McKayla Young is a passionate leader, mentor, and advocate for personal growth and empowerment. Currently serving as Miss Smithfield 2025 with the Miss America Organization, McKayla is proudly preparing to compete for the title of Miss North Carolina on June 28 in High Point. Through her journey, she is committed to using her platform to inspire change and opportunity for others, championing her initiative, Polished Pathways. Through Polished Pathways, McKayla works to ensure that homelessness and poverty are not life sentences, propelling individuals toward their fullest potential with the proper resources and support they need to thrive.
Beyond the crown, McKayla hosts Surviving the Wilderness, a podcast that explores how faith intersects with everyday life, encouraging listeners to become the brightest and boldest versions of themselves. Her life’s work reflects her deep belief in the transformative power of faith, education, and resilience.
McKayla’s pageant experience highlights her longstanding dedication to excellence and service, having previously served as Miss Omega Psi Phi 2019–2020 and earning second runner-up honors in the Miss Black Talented Teen North Carolina pageant in 2014.
A proud member of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ority, Incorporated (Rho Psi Omega chapter), McKayla exemplifies the ideals of sisterhood, leadership, and service in everything she does.
Professionally, she serves as the Director of Student Transition and Engagement at North Carolina Central University, where she oversees the Aspiring Eagles Academy program, mentoring and empowering first-year college students as they transition into higher education and adulthood.
McKayla holds both undergraduate and master’s degrees in Biological and Biomedical Sciences from NCCU and is currently pursuing her doctorate in Psychology – Theology at Liberty University. Her academic and professional pursuits align with her mission to uplift and empower others through biblical counseling, leadership development, and educational advocacy.
